Actually, I have quite some mixed feelings about this post, but for the learning purpose I am going to do it nevertheless.
As pointed out earlier the problem is easy to identify. You need to download quite a few additional files to run the game locally.
To identify the needed files you can use a program like URL Snooper, a Flash-Decompiler or even a Hex-Editor. Using one of these tools you might be able to identify the missing files. To play the game locally you need to download all of the following files from http://americandadvsfamilyguy.com/:
- main.swf
- intro.swf
- RyuB.swf
- Stan.swf
- Brian.swf
- Steve.swf
- Lois.swf
- Peter.swf
- Stewie.swf
- Roger.swf
- Klaus.swf
- Hayley.swf
- Chris.swf
- Francine.swf
- Meg.swf
All these files must be placed in the same folder. If you now open the main. swf in your browser the intro should load and you should be able to play the game locally.
